Olsenboye by Mary-Kate & Ashley


Mary-Kate and Ashley Olsen have gone back to their fashion roots by re-creating an affordable fashion line for their adoring fans. The new line is named Olsenboye- 'Olsen' following their surnames and 'Boye' as a homage to their norweign ancestrial surnames, which is both fitting and meaningful.
The new line previewed on ABC News and will be exclusively stocked at J.C Penney and in their own words it is targeted at "tweens & teens", priced at between $20 and $50 a piece. It will be officially available in February 2010 and will feature a few key pieces including denim jeans and easy to wear plaid shirts that go beyond their target market and wearable by any age group.

Posh Peepers: Nicole Richie

Miss Nicole Richie is known for her unique taste when it comes to sunglasses. The tiny starlet confessed to having over 200 pairs of sunglasses (and counting) in her collection, which include both designer and vintage frames. The most recent addition to her collection is a pair of Theirry Lasry 'Velvety' sunglasses.

Clearly her favourite new pair, these sunglasses feature a glossy black frame which can only be described as a hybrid between a cat-eye and wayfarer style.

Perhaps this will be the start of celebrities embracing the 1950's cat-eye trend that has been promoted by several eyewear designers including Pollini, Gucci, Oliver Peoples, Dita and Tom Ford over the past few seasons.
